-- $usage
--
-- You can use this module with the following in your @~\/.xmonad\/xmonad.hs@:
--
-- > import XMonad.Actions.RotView
--
-- Then add appropriate key bindings, such as:
--
-- >   , ((modMask x .|. shiftMask, xK_Right), rotView True)
-- >   , ((modMask x .|. shiftMask, xK_Left), rotView False)
--
-- For detailed instructions on editing your key bindings, see
-- "XMonad.Doc.Extending#Editing_key_bindings".

-- | Cycle through non-empty workspaces.  True --> cycle in the forward
--   direction.  Note that workspaces cycle in order by tag, so if your
--   workspaces are not in tag-order, the cycling might seem wonky.
rotView :: Bool -> X ()
rotView forward = do
    ws <- gets windowset
    let currentTag = tag . workspace . current $ ws
        sortWs     = sortBy (comparing tag)
        isNotEmpty = isJust . stack
        sorted     = sortWs (hidden ws)
        pivoted    = let (a,b) = span ((< currentTag) . tag) sorted in b ++ a
        pivoted'   | forward   = pivoted
                   | otherwise = reverse pivoted
        nextws     = find isNotEmpty pivoted'
    whenJust nextws (windows . view . tag)
